Federal Councillor Didier Burkhalter to participate in conference on Somalia in London

Federal Councillor Didier Burkhalter, Head of the Federal Department of Foreign Affairs (FDFA), will participate in the international conference on Somalia to be held on 23 February 2012 in London. Switzerland – via its humanitarian assistance and the office of its special representative to Sudan, Southern Sudan and the Horn of Africa (BSSA) – is working to promote stabilisation in Somalia. It allocated around 40 million Swiss francs in 2011 to projects in this region of eastern Africa.

Great Britain has invited representatives of the international community, including Switzerland, to a conference on Somalia. The conference, to be held in London on 23 February, seeks to achieve better coordination of support from the international community and to organise the latter's commitment beyond August 2012, when the Somali federal transitional institutions' mandate is due to end.

At this conference, particular attention will be paid to the political and constitutional processes initiated in Somalia following the adoption of the road map designed to help the country out of transition. Switzerland, strongly engaged in the region through its humanitarian aid, deems a commitment on the part of the international community to strengthen the coordination of aid as being a priority in the process of consolidating stability in the region.
